AS Roma manager Jose Mourinho has been handed a four-match ban by UEFA for his misconduct towards referee Anthony Taylor in the Europa League final. Mourinho was charged by UEFA for using insulting or abusive language towards the English official after Roma lost to Sevilla in the heated final on May 31. An Accra High Court has adjourned to Friday, June 23 the criminal case involving National Democratic Congress’ Parliamentary Candidate for the Assin North by-election, James Gyakye Quayson. The deposed MP was on Wednesday, June 21 granted permission, however, to be absent from the next hearing. Saudi Arabian clubs have expressed interest in signing Arsenal midfielder Thomas Partey, with a potential transfer fee of €40 million. The proposed payment would be made in instalments, making it an appealing option for the North London club. Nkawkaw-based cub Okwahu United have returned to Ghana’s Division One League after winning the Eastern Region Division Two Middle League. The Asaase Aban team earned promotion with a 3-1 win over Blue Skies Pelicans in their final game on Wednesday.
